How they compare

El Salvador currently reports 8.8% against 7.0% in Bolivia, Plurinational State of, a difference of 1.8%.

That makes El Salvador's figure about 1.3 times Bolivia, Plurinational State of's.

Across all 10 years both countries report, El Salvador has been ahead every year.

Bolivia, Plurinational State of ranks 71st and El Salvador ranks 68th of 112 countries.

El Salvador has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

Social contributions are actual or imputed contributions payable to social insurance schemes to make provisions for social benefits to be paid. This indicator is expressed as a percentage of revenue which includes all transactions that add to the amount of economic value of a unit or sector.
